Transaction 74ba3d6c1a781929c1665551350ab642eb0b862600054c2f2a24c47507241478
1 Input
1 Output
-
74ba3d6c1a781929c1665551350ab642eb0b862600054c2f2a24c47507241478:0
- value
- 14274874
- script pubkey
- OP_0 OP_PUSHBYTES_20 10bd3895a9d78a9070d5088913d66233ef2794b8
- address
- bc1qzz7n39df679fqux4pzy384nzx0hj099cz6zatd